Does blue LED light help sleep

Blue light suppresses the body's release of melatonin. View Source , a hormone that makes us feel drowsy. While this promotes wakefulness during the day, it becomes unhelpful at night when we are trying to sleep.

Is white LED light good for sleep

'Cool white' LEDs (>5000K) emit more blue light and are therefore more disruptive than 'warm white' LEDS (<3000K). Unfortunately even the 'warm white' LED products still emit significant amounts of blue light (see figure above) – too much to be safely used at night, especially for those of us who have trouble sleeping.

Do purple lights help you sleep

However, it was green light that produced rapid sleep onset – between 1 and 3 minutes. Blue and violet light delayed sleep – the onset of sleep taking between 16 and 19 minutes for blue and between 5 and 10 minutes for violet.
